A journey wouldn’t be complete without venturing beyond the typical tourist spots and indulging in the local cuisine. Join this culinary tour through the heart of Barranquilla to experience the finest of Caribbean food and culture. Delight in carimañola, arepa de huevo, butifarra, chipi chipi rice, enyucado, and many other delectable options. This…

A great way to experience Barranquilla! - What a wonderful way to explore and learn about Barranquilla. It was a great combination of sightseeing, history and a lot of good local food! You will be visiting small kiosks and food stands; it is not fancy. The food is diverse and filling. I tried a local rice dish, shrimp cocktail , cheese , empanadas, frozen ice , fruit and coconut water to name a few of the treats. It was nonstop. I was able to experience the downtown area, the boardwalk and a nature preserve. There was plenty of time for photos. My guide, Andrés, was very punctual and organized. He was passionate about sharing his culture with me! He also took the time to make other recommendations to me regarding restaurants etc. Tips-Bring some extra water , cash, hand sanitizer wipes and a small backpack.
